I have a quicksilver exhaust but I am thinking about switching too the ap one. Even though the Quicksilver sounds amazing and has no drone the fitment isnt 100%. Ive gotten two of them and both had some issues. The current one the passenger side muffler angle doesnt match the driver side. It isnt terrible and I am probably the only one who notices but still its there. But sound wise I havent heard a better sounding exhaust period, and the carbon tips look amazing.
